Ocean Career: SIO Senior Marine Mechanician

The Marine Physical Laboratory Division at the Scripps Institution of Oceanography at UC San Diego is seeking a highly experienced Senior Marine Mechanician. Under general supervision, the Senior Marine Mechanician performs highly skilled machining and fabrication tasks in support of cutting-edge oceanographic research projects as well as external collaborations with aerospace and defense industries. Core responsibilities include precision machining on Haas CNC (Computer Numerical Control) mills and lathes, ProtoTRAK controlled mills, manual mills and lathes, and OMAX water jet equipment. Programming responsibilities include utilizing Mastercam software and interpreting SolidWorks CAD (Computer aided design) models to produce complex, tight-tolerance components.

The position requires a minimum of seven years overall machining experience, including at least five years recent experience operating CNC mills and lathes with Mastercam programming. The successful candidate must demonstrate proven competence in both CNC and manual machining, including the ability to efficiently utilize Mastercam’s modern toolpaths, apply GD&T (Geometric Dimensioning and Tolerancing) principles, and consistently produce tight-tolerance components (<.001”) from materials such as aluminum, titanium, stainless steel, copper, and plastics.

While machining is the primary focus, the role may also involve occasional fabrication, assembly, shop equipment maintenance, and support of shipboard or marine-related mechanical systems. The ideal candidate is a self-starter who takes pride in their work, communicates effectively with researchers and engineers, and adapts seamlessly between oceanographic prototypes and aerospace/defense projects.
